Understanding the Chemistry

The 12.8 Volt lithium battery typically refers to lithium iron phosphate (LiFePO4) chemistry. I found that this particular chemistry offers several advantages, such as enhanced safety features and thermal stability. The battery operates at a nominal voltage of 12.8 volts, which is ideal for most 12-volt systems.

Capacity and Size

Capacity is a crucial factor to consider when buying a 12.8 Volt lithium battery. I realized that battery capacity is measured in amp-hours (Ah). The higher the amp-hour rating, the longer the battery can provide power before needing a recharge. I recommend matching the capacity to my specific power needs and the space available for installation.

Charging and Discharging Rates

I learned that charging and discharging rates can vary significantly among lithium batteries. It’s essential to check the specifications for the maximum charge and discharge current to ensure it meets my needs. Fast charging capabilities are an added bonus, which allows me to get back to using my devices quickly.

Lifespan and Cycle Life

One of the most appealing aspects of 12.8 Volt lithium batteries is their long lifespan. I discovered that these batteries can last for thousands of cycles, often exceeding 2000 cycles at 80% depth of discharge. This longevity means I can enjoy a reliable power source for years without frequent replacements.

Temperature Tolerance

Temperature can affect battery performance and lifespan. I found that many 12.8 Volt lithium batteries perform well in a wide range of temperatures, making them suitable for various environments. However, it’s crucial to check the manufacturer’s specifications for optimal operating temperatures.

Safety Features

Safety is always a top priority for me when selecting a battery. I noticed that many 12.8 Volt lithium batteries come equipped with built-in protection circuits to prevent overcharging, over-discharging, and short circuits. These features provide peace of mind and enhance the overall safety of my battery usage.

Cost Considerations

While 12.8 Volt lithium batteries may have a higher upfront cost compared to traditional batteries, I found that their longevity and efficiency often make them more cost-effective in the long run. It’s essential to weigh the initial investment against the potential savings in replacement costs over time.
